ESP8266-EvilTwin v2:一款创新的Wi-Fi安全测试工具
1、项目介绍
ESP8266-EvilTwin v2 是一个基于 ESP8266 模块的开源项目,其灵感来源于 vk496/linset 和 SpacehuhnTech/esp8266_deauther。这个项目的主要功能是创建一个恶意的 Wi-Fi 中继,用于安全测试和验证网络防御策略。重要的是,仅应在您有权访问的网络上使用此工具。
2、项目技术分析
该项目摒弃了原先的 AsyncWebServer,以提高性能和稳定性。deauthing 功能经过重构,现在能够更有效地在不同频道之间切换,实现持续的去认证攻击。为了进行这种攻击,该工具利用了 wifi_send_pkt_freedom
功能,这是 Arduino ESP8266 库的一个关键部分。
HTML 页面可以通过直接编辑字符串来个性化设置,未来版本可能会引入 char 数组以进一步提升稳定性和效率。此外,项目还提供了简单的用户界面,让用户可以选择目标网络并启动或停止去认证操作。
3、项目及技术应用场景
- 网络安全审计:网络管理员可以使用 ESP8266-EvilTwin 来检测网络的脆弱性,测试安全策略的有效性。
- 教学与研究:网络安全专业的学生和教师可以借此了解 Wi-Fi 网络的安全漏洞,并学习如何防止此类攻击。
- 产品开发:硬件开发者可以研究 ESP8266 的潜在应用,如自定义无线接入点解决方案。
4、项目特点
- 易用性:连接到预设 AP,选择目标网络,然后启动攻击,用户界面直观简单。
- 广播式攻击:对网络中的所有设备进行去认证,而非特定客户端,提高了攻击的广度。
- 动态频道切换:改变频道执行去认证,提高了攻击的成功率。
- 密码捕获:当有人尝试使用正确密码时,AP 会重启并显示密码信息。
- 灵活性:用户可自由编辑 HTML 页面以定制界面,也可以为项目提出建议和问题。
如果你对 Wi-Fi 安全有深入的兴趣,或者需要一个测试网络防护的实用工具,那么 ESP8266-EvilTwin v2 绝对值得一试。只需按照说明编译上传代码,即可开启你的安全探索之旅。记得,在使用过程中始终尊重他人的网络隐私权。